Job description

Guglielmo & Associates, PLLC is a multi-state, debt collection law firm based in Tucson. We are a nationally recognized law firm looking for the brightest and hardest working talent in the industry to continue our competitive edge in the market.

At Guglielmo & Associates PLLC, we’re committed to delivering exceptional customer experiences. As part of our mission to continuously improve service quality, we’re looking for a detail-oriented and collaborative Complaints & Disputes Analyst I to join our team in our Tucson office. This role is critical in ensuring consistency, compliance, and excellence across all customer interactions. Qualified candidates will have strong background in compliance and a willingness to work in accurate yet fast paced environment. Bilingual a plus!

Full-time benefits after introductory period include Vacation, PTO and Holiday pay. Great medical benefits including dental and vision and 401(k) with the potential for profit sharing.

Background Check, Drug Test, and Credit Check - No Felonies.

Responsibilities:

  • Monitor and evaluate customer correspondence for quality and compliance;
  • Determine appropriate processing routes based on internal standards and escalation criteria;
  • Collaborate with internal teams to ensure timely resolution of complaints/disputes;
  • Conduct ad hoc audits to support compliance oversight and quality assurance;
  • Identify trends and recommend improvements to training and processes;
  • Comply with office Policies and Procedures;
  • Comply with local and national laws and regulation;
  • Document detailed and accurate notes within our office collection software

Skills:

  • Strong listening and communication skills
  • FDCPA knowledge is preferred
  • Effective decision making
  • Excellent work ethic and attendance
  • Ability to work efficiently on the computer
  • Ability to work in a fast-paced environment and multi-task
  • Bilingual (Spanish) is a plus
